The Student Center for Science Engagement Annual Symposium

Each year the SCSE facilitates a student STEM symposium that highlights the research activities of our STEM students. These students participate in podium presentations, poster sessions, and attend a keynote address and networking lunch with distinguished guests, mentors, faculty, and peers. The SCSE Symposium invites students who completed research internships either through our office at NEIU, or at an external site, to present what they learned on the topic or subfield within STEM. Participants from local community collages are also invited to apply with an abstract, and attendance to this single-day event is free for all. 

The SCSE Symposium began in 2008 and continues to be an annual occurrence during the Fall semester. If you or someone you know is interested in presenting at our symposium or being a featured speaker, please reach out to SCSE@neiu.edu for more information.
